The first table below looks at the demand for GSM skills in IT contracts advertised for the England region. Included is a guide to the average contractor rates offered in IT contracts that have cited GSM over the 3 months to 19 June 2013 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years. The second table is for comparison and provides aggregates for all of the Communications & Networking category for the England region.

Note that daily contractor rates and hourly contractor rates are treated separately. When calculating average contractor rates, daily rates are not derived from quoted hourly rates or vice versa.
